  • Riane Eisler

    Austrian-American sociologist (born 1931)

    Riane Tennenhaus Eisler (born July 22, 1931) is an Austrian-born American systems scientist, futurist, attorney, and author who writes about the effect of gender and family politics historically on societies, and vice versa.

    She is best known for her 1987 book, The Chalice and the Blade, in which she coined the terms "partnership" and "dominator".[1][2]

    She has written and been interviewed in over 500 articles.

    Her work is covered in publications ranging from Scientific American, Behavioral Science, Futures, Political Psychology, The Christian Science Monitor, Challenge, and UNESCO Courier to Brain and Mind, Human Rights Quarterly, International Journal of Women's Studies, and World Encyclopedia of Peace, as well as chapters for books published by trade and university presses (e.g., Cambridge, Stanford, and Oxford University).
